# Allow workers to create POs in Cost tracking

> [!NOTE]
> *POs* are permission based
> 
> To allow workers to create *POs* in [Cost tracking](/v1/docs/about-cost-tracking), your account must have one of the following [roles](/v1/docs/permissions-and-access-control) enabled:
> 
> - Role: *Company Admin, Company Manager, or Project Coordinator*
> - Custom role with:
>   - *Accounting & Cost Tracking* / *Purchase orders* - *Full access*, *Manage*, *Approve only*, or *View only*

If you have workers who need to generate POs during a production, you can enable them from the project’s *Purchase orders* dashboard.

When a project worker is allowed to create POs, they can:

- Create new POs
- View POs they’ve created
- See the total dollar amount of their POs
- See POs that are awaiting invoice, paid, and unpaid
- Export POs to HotBudget or Showbiz

To allow workers to create POs:

1. From the left-side navigation, click the dropdown menu
2. Select the name of the project that you want to enable worker purchase orders for
3. In the project dashboard’s *Purchase orders* overview, click **View POs**
4. On the *Purchase Orders* page, click the **Enable workers** button
5. In the *Enable purchase orders for workers* popup, click the checkbox next to each worker you want to enable
6. When you’re finished making your selections, click the **Save Permissions** button
